A Next Big Idea Club Must-Read A compelling and accessible new perspective on the modern science of psychology, based on one of Yales most popular courses of all time How does the braina three-pound wrinkly massgive rise to intelligence and conscious experience? Was Freud right that we are all plagued by forbidden sexual desires? What is the function of emotions such as disgust, gratitude, and shame? Renowned psychologist Paul Bloom answers these questions and many more in Psych, his riveting new book about the science of the mind. Psych is an expert and passionate guide to the most intimate aspects of our nature, serving up the equivalent of a serious university course while being funny, engaging, and full of memorable anecdotes. But Psych is much more than a comprehensive overview of the field of psychology. Bloom reveals what psychology can tell us about the most pressing moral and political issues of our timeincluding belief in conspiracy theories, the role of genes in explaining human differences, and the nature of prejudice and hatred. Bloom also shows how psychology can give us practical insights into important issuesfrom the treatment of mental illnesses such as depression and anxiety to the best way to lead happy and fulfilling lives.Psych is an engrossing guide to the most important topic there is: it is the story of us.
